How to Create Your Own Marshmello-Inspired Remix

Okay, so you're inspired and ready to create your own Marshmello-inspired remix? Awesome! Here’s a breakdown to get you started. First things first: choosing the right song. Look for tracks with strong melodies and vocals that you can really work with. Pop songs, R&B tracks, and even some indie tunes can be great starting points. Once you've got your song, it's time to fire up your DAW (Digital Audio Workstation). Ableton Live, FL Studio, Logic Pro – whatever you're comfortable with! Now, start by analyzing the original track. Identify the key elements – the melody, the chords, the rhythm – and think about how you can transform them. Experiment with different tempos, keys, and time signatures to see what works best. Next up, start building your new beat. Marshmello's sound is characterized by heavy basslines, so make sure you've got a solid foundation. Add layers of synths to create those bright, melodic textures that are his signature. Don't be afraid to experiment with different sounds and effects until you find something that really stands out. Arrangement is key! Think about how you can build tension and release throughout the remix. Use filters, volume automation, and other techniques to create dynamic transitions. Don't be afraid to strip away elements and then bring them back in unexpected ways to keep the listener engaged. Pay close attention to the mixing and mastering process. A clean and polished mix is essential for a professional-sounding remix. Use EQ, compression, and other tools to balance the different elements of your track and make sure everything sounds clear and crisp. Finally, get feedback! Share your remix with friends, fellow producers, and online communities to get their opinions. Be open to criticism and use it to improve your track. Tips and Tricks for Remixing Like a Pro

Ready to elevate your remixing game? Let's get into some pro tips and tricks that can help you create killer tracks. First off, master the art of sampling. Sampling is a fundamental part of remixing, so learn how to chop, pitch-shift, and manipulate samples to create your own unique sounds. Experiment with different techniques like time-stretching, looping, and reversing to create interesting textures and rhythms. Another key skill is understanding music theory. Knowing about chords, scales, and harmonies can help you create more melodic and engaging remixes. Learn how to identify the key of a song and how to create chord progressions that complement the original melody. Don't be afraid to experiment with different genres. Remixing is all about pushing boundaries, so try blending different styles and influences to create something truly unique. Combine elements of EDM, hip-hop, pop, and even classical music to create your own signature sound. Pay attention to the dynamics of your remix. Create contrast between the loud and quiet parts of your track to keep the listener engaged. Use automation to control the volume, filters, and other effects to create dynamic transitions and build tension. Learn how to create effective build-ups and drops. A well-executed build-up can create anticipation and excitement, while a powerful drop can release that energy in a satisfying way. Experiment with different techniques like risers, sweeps, and white noise to create dramatic build-ups. Don't be afraid to get weird.
